On 8/17/06, Mattias <[EMAIL PROTECTED]> wrote:
Now we need some nice function names for the LCL.
In some sense fullscreen is a windowstate. So maybe we should add it
'wsFullScreen' to TWindowState. OTOH a fullscreen is just a
special wsMaximized, so a FullScreen boolean property might be better.
Comments?
In my own Free Pascal widget set, I debated the same issue a few weeks
back. I concluded that the Window State method using 'wsFullScreen' is
the better approach. The reason being - if you look at the
BorderSyle, you can have Dialogs Windows and Tool Windows. They are
pretty much the same thing, just the title bar is different (and
sometimes the border resize feature). In other words Tool Windows are
a special (or specialized) Dialog - as far as I am concerned. Same as
what wsFullScreen is a special (or specialized) wsMaximized.
Regards,
- Graeme -
--
There's no place like 127.0.0.1
_________________________________________________________________
To unsubscribe: mail [EMAIL PROTECTED] with
"unsubscribe" as the Subject
archives at http://www.lazarus.freepascal.org/mailarchives